NewEn Australia Pares Expectations for Salt Creek Windfarm to 12 Megawatts

Researched by Industrial Info Resources (Perth, Australia)--NewEn Australia Pty Limited (Melbourne, Australia), a renewable energy company based in Australia, is conducting engineering and final design on the proposed 12-megawatt (MW) Salt Creek Windfarm project in Australia. The company has already received capital approvals and consents for the project and is currently working on the final design to revise the size and capacity of the windfarm.

NewEn Australia is proposing to build the windfarm at Salt Creek, which is south of Woorndoo, Victoria. The initial project proposal planned for 15 turbines of 3-MW each to produce approximately 45 MW of electricity. However, due to the new regulations and market demands, NewEn has decided to redesign the project with fewer turbines to produce only 12 MW of electricity.

The windfarm was granted with planning permits in 2007; however, NewEn had to deal with more than 200 conditions and sub-conditions, before the capital approval was granted in 2012. NewEn had several negotiations with Powercor for access to the transmission line, which was an additional cause for the delay in project development.

According to the revised design, Salt Creek will be built only with six 2-MW turbines to produce approximately 12 MW of electricity. The project is in its preliminary engineering phase, and the company is planning to begin the construction by the end of 2014. Overall construction is expected to take about 10 months, and the completion is expected in 2015.

NewEn Australia is investing $1 billion in two windfarm projects in Australia.

The Dundonnell project will have an installed capacity of 270 MW and will consist of 90 turbines of 3 MW each. The project is at the Dundonnell, near the proposed Salt Creek windfarm. At the moment, the project is in its detailed design phase. Construction at the site is expected to begin in February 2015 and last about 24 to 27 months.

The Wingeel Project is another windfarm in its very early stages, and is planned to produce a total output of 200 MW, equipped with 80 turbines. NewEn expects to start construction of this windfarm by end of 2015. Both these projects together will produce enough electricity to 4,000 homes in Victoria.
